The Lutheran World Federation Myanmar an international non-government organization serving the people of Myanmar in the delta region. Since 2008 LWF is working with 51 villages of Bogalay, Deydaye, Pyapon and Twantay. Since 2013 LWF has started project in Chin State. It will soon start in Kayin and Rakhine State. LWF works in the areas of Disaster Risk Reduction, Livelihood, Child and Youth Development, Child and Maternal health, WASH, Education and Psychosocial. It works with marginalized communities a Internally Displaced Persons (IDP).
The working approach of LWF is Rights Based B Empowerment, Work king with the Government Structures and Integrated. The strategic objectives of LWF are Community Empowerment, Sustainable Liivelihood and Emergency Response and Disaster Risk Management. It is guide values such as Dignity y and Justice, Inclusion and Participation, Accountability y and Transparency, Compassion and Commitment.
